What the numbers tell you

Synthesis from the official RERA scale, unit register, and land rows — the read a sales team won't volunteer.

Unit formatAverage official carpet area is ~268 sqft — compact homes (1–2BHK / studio territory), not compact stock. This is a boutique, low-density project — 35 homes across 1 tower. Carpet is the RERA-defined usable area, so compare it against the 'super built-up' a broker quotes (typically 25–35% larger).
ParkingThe registration form discloses 14 parking spaces, but the official unit register allots 35 lots across 35 of 35 unit rows (~1.0 per home) — read the form figure as the separately-disclosed lots, not total supply, and confirm your unit's allotted lots in the agreement.
Your land share (UDS)Undivided land share averages ~3 sqm per home; across all 35 homes that is ~17% of the plot — the undivided shares sum to less than the plot area.

Named utility/regulatory approvals

Electricity (BESCOM/ESCOM)✓ On file (Electricity Permission Letter)
Water & sewage (BWSSB/KWSSB)Not found in catalog
Fire NOC✓ On file (Fire Force Department)
Pollution control (KSPCB)Not found in catalog
Environmental clearanceNot found in catalog
Airport Authority height clearanceNot found in catalog

"Not found in catalog" can mean the approval genuinely isn't on file yet, or that it doesn't apply to this project (K-RERA doesn't tell us which). Ask the builder directly for any marked not found before relying on it.

⚠ No quarterly financial disclosures (collections, escrow withdrawals) on record, despite no completion certificate yet — meaning we can't verify the project's cashflows against its construction progress. Worth asking the builder directly why no quarterly filings are available.

Declared construction cost ÷ registered units averages to ₹8.0 lakhs per unit — the developer's own declared construction/development cost, not a sale price. K-RERA filings don't disclose what the builder is charging, so this can't tell you whether you're getting a fair deal — only you comparing your quoted price against comparable listings nearby can answer that.

RERA 70% project account is on file: Industrial Development Bank of India Kankanady Mangalore IFSC Code : IBKL0000078 Pin Code : 575002. RERA requires 70% of buyer collections to sit in this separate, project-specific account, drawn only against certified construction milestones — confirm your payments are made to THIS account (not a general builder account) and that it appears on your allotment letter.

ATS Knightsbridge · Sector 124, Noida

You pay for 10,000 sq ft. The floor inside your home is 6,982 sq ft. The rest is walls, shared circulation and services. Get both numbers written into your agreement before you pay any booking amount.

Oberoi Elysian · Goregaon East, Mumbai

“The building is complete.” The tower has reached full height — true. The same filed certificate, same page: sanitary fittings 6% done. Ask for a possession date in writing.

Godrej Aristocrat · Sector 49, Gurugram

Paying extra for the top floor? The terrace drawing shows what sits on the slab above those flats: the overhead water tanks, the lift machine rooms and the roof machinery. Ask which flat sits under which.

Prestige Camden Gardens · Thanisandra, Bengaluru

The approved parking table asks for 12 visitor spaces. It shows 0. Two-wheeler spaces: also 0. Ask in writing where visitors will park.
